Published Date: 14 June 2009
ENLIGHTENED Training is launching a centre at The Hub, part of Glasgow's Digital Media Quarter in Pacific Quay, to host courses in IT and "soft" skills such as time management.
Leeds-headquartered Enlightened Training's clients include FTSE 100 companies, small and medium-sized companies, government agencies and not-for-profit companies.

John McGlinchey, director of sales, said: "Our move to The Hub means we can significantly increase the scale of our operation within Scotland."
